1) Install Proton Easy Anti Cheat runtime, under tools.
2) Configure PEAC to have launch command of "install 58dec5a58e8f4ce6beca223311f65b4c"
3) Install Proton Experimental.
4) Configure Throne and Liberty to use Proton Experimental under compatibility.
5) Configure Proton Experimental to use beta program - Bleeding Edge.
Doing this, I finally got past that dumb spinning triangle circle. Took 12 hours because there's no error popups, no messages, nothing at all to give a hint as to what the issue was.
